We ceased at Lamayuru Village first. It has a fantastic cloister where we were the main guests! It is excellent as any town in Ladakh!
Alchi is one of the most established religious community in Ladakh. It has four edifices with staggering sketches on its dividers. To safeguard it, no photography is permitted inside it.
